At issue is Anthony Davis’ injury status for the Pistons matchup



The Dallas Mavericks have been a huge disappointment so far in the 2025-26 NBA season, currently 10-17 heading into Thursday night’s showdown against the Detroit Pistons. Anthony Davis was in and out of the lineup due to injury as a trade rumors are swirling around the Mavericks amid their difficult start to the season.

Most recently, Mavericks got an update on Davis’ status for the game against the Pistons.

“Anthony Davis (left calf injury) will remain questionable for Thursday’s home game against Detroit, Mavericks coach Jason Kidd says. Davis missed Monday’s game at Utah after playing the previous six,” NBA insider Marc Stein reported on X, formerly Twitter.

Coincidentally, the Pistons have been one of the teams that have emerged as a potential trade suitor for Davis as they look to capitalize on their hot start to the season, currently leading the Eastern Conference by 2.5 games over the second-place New York Knicks.

Meanwhile, the Mavericks have plenty of incentive to start calling up some of their veterans as they look to embrace a new era built around first-round draft pick Cooper Flagg, who recently became the first 18-year-old in NBA history to score 40 points in a game.

All in all, the Mavericks weren’t necessarily expected to be a legitimate contender this year, but it’s safe to say the team was hoping for a much better start than what they’ve shown so far.

Either way, the Mavericks and Pistons are scheduled to tip things off on Thursday at 8:30 PM ET.
